A female undergraduate at Tai Solarin University of Education (TASUED), who studies computer science, has sparked discussions online after sharing her strict criteria for dating and financial expectations.
In a video that has gone viral, she revealed that she is not interested in dating men who earn less than ₦5 million per month.
She emphasized that a man’s income is a key factor in her romantic choices, categorizing those earning between ₦1 million and ₦2 million monthly as “poor.”
She further stated that men making under ₦1 million are only considered suitable for casual friendships, adding that she might approach them solely for minor emergency assistance.
For a serious romantic relationship, she insists her partner must earn a minimum of ₦5 million per month and provide substantial financial support.
